5 ARCHITECTURAL DESIGN The name LegoCad represents the way a building is assembled; this software is based on a data-base of parametric formwork and is customized for each client. It allows a three-dimensional architectural assembly of the building, while operating with a two-dimensional approach. After defining a structural mesh, columns, consoles, coverage elements, slabs and walls are positioned; in the design assembly phase changes and modifications can be made at any time. All drawings (views) are complete with dimensions that are automatically positioned, these drawings contain all elements needed for design; the position of the details are optimized following standardization requirements from different Customers. Eventually when the design is changed all the drawings are updated automatically (drawings and quotas).

9 STRUCTURAL CALCULATION LegoCad is able, starting from the architectural design, to develop the 3D frame of the structure and to calculate the self - weights of each element related to its geometric and mechanical characteristics. The program also allows to assign dead and live loads, directly applied to the structural elements. The structural frame obtained can be interfaced with various calculation and verification programs. During the calculation phase, linear and non linear static analysis (included second geometric order), dynamic modal response spectrum analysis are performed, according to existing rules (eg. Euro Codes) and as required by the customer. It is possible to get both graphical and numerical information from results of calculation; the deflected shape of structure and actions diagrams for each element can be shown.

10 The results are grouped into a database for easy consultation, allowing a flexible and fast identification of critical strength-displacement situations. Output data list is defined by user. Assuming a type of steel reinforcement and stirrups for the column, it is finally possible to calculate the resistant interaction curve for all significant sections and check them.

11 KNOTS The fixing connections are very important for the concrete precast structures because, through them, the linkages among the different structural elements that constitute the building are executed. The connections are subject to vertical and horizontal actions, as for example their own weight, wind and seismic actions, and for this reason they must be designed and checked to transmit all the stress actions, to prevent sinkings or settlements not expected in the design phase. Once the architectural design phase is ended, LegoCad allows to analyze and to position the knots that fix the structural precast elements to each other. Knots loaded in LegoCad can be commercial connections or user defined connections. Only in specific situations (non standard knots ) the inserts will be positioned one by one. LegoCad includes an archive of standard knots (commonly used in the market and used by concrete manufacturer) for the following connections: Footing Column Column Beam Beam Beam Beam Slab Panel Column Panel Beam Panel Slab Panel Panel Slab - Dome Panel - Panel

12 During knots insertion, once the user has defined the type of connection to be used, LegoCad goes on by placing the respective inserts (boxes, profiles, ) on the different elements considering the production companies rules, also checking distances from elements side, the capacity for suspension elements, any interference among different inserts. When restrictions are not respected LegoCad reports the error to the user. How to use Example of panel-column knot: Once the architectural design is ended, the user chooses, from the KNOT menu, the knot typology to insert, for example panel column (PAN-COL). Automatically all typologies on market and stored in the archive are proposed. After choosing the knot, the user, driven step by step by the program, defines the elements where to apply the inserts. The program automatically positions the inserts, building the knot, on the panel and on the column. Any change in the knot position on the architectural design will determine the update of the inserts positions in the elements carpentry drawings. In specific situations, when it is not possible to use commercial knots, it is possible to use generic knots defined by the user. While closing the order, the program automatically generates the used knots and the kit cast and assembly inserts summaries.

15 PANELS DESIGN General Parameters: - Geometrical features, characteristics of materials (including maximum strengths allowed for different verification step ), steel reinforcements logic and positioning of polystyrenes, abutment stones. - Loads agents: in addition to own weight, wind (allocation of increased involved area), earthquake. Analysis of stress in various steps: - Shakeout - Lifting - Own weight - Wind - Earthquake Calculation of minimum areas of reinforcement. K heat: Calculation of thermal conductivity, carried out in accordance with the standards UNI EN ISO 6946 and subsequent changes. The amount of heat that passes through the panel is calculated considering the material type and sections. Kn Ko

17 PRODUCTION AUTOMATION The integration between the design and production processes makes possible to reset errors, to reduce the time needed to communicate between technical and production departments, to avoid conflicting documents because of missing updates and manage Customer s change requests in real-time. The designer enables the production of the verified elements and not subject to variations, he may also assign assembly stages related priorities to buildings constraints or to sequence of the assembly itself. The technical designer defines the filling of moulds for the coming working days selecting elements of the same order. For example picking one panel, this is placed on the mould, it is hatched and the date of production planning is added. It is possible to optimize production, switching from one order to another; the production plan can be easily updated using commands like move day of production, re-optimize mould etc.

18 The planning can provide the following reports for each day / cycle processing (sorted by positioning mould): Layout general drawing including the percentage of capacity usage. Drawings of each mould Summary of concrete, cast stones and finishing with possible separation between 1st and 2nd cast. Summary of inserts, connections, lifting and lightening sized elements. Summary of steel reinforcements by type, diameter and moulding. Executive sketches of the precast elements, in this way the table is printed at the time of production and there is no risk to have not updated versions. Production cards with code and characteristics of precast elements. CAD-CAM files UNITECHNIK format needed for production automation, for the geometry of the elements, the positioning of inserts, the types of processing, etc. CAD-CAM files BVBS format for reinforcement cuts and bending. 35 INTERACTION CURVES To properly size precast elements in the offers, it is important to estimate the useful section and the quantity of reinforcement. The use of load diagrams created at the ultimate limit states allows to perform a PRESIZING that will be confirmed by final results of calculations. The use of the COLUMN s interaction curves is particularly useful in case of compression and bending columns with load applied at different levels; such situation is referable to one equivalent column blocked at the base with only one load applied to the extremity and with a new equivalent height H to be used in the interaction curve. The diagram considers also the unfavorable effects of the second order.

36 For the horizontal elements, BEAMS and SLABS, the interaction curves build a relationship among loads and elements length with number of strands and reinforcement incidence. Interaction curves allow to estimate starting from offer phase the real costs of elements. Tabs, executable for each types of prestressed elements, prepared using the input data of the Company (geometry, materials, strands map; rules for stirrups and steel rebars), also considering the fire resistance, provide the optimal combinations for: LENGTH + LOADS STRANDS NUMBER & STEEL INCIDENCE
